    CURRENT Diagnosis & Treatment Nephrology & Hypertension

    AvAllen Nissenson,Jeffrey Berns

    Häftad, Engelska, 2009

    Del i serien LANGE CURRENT Series

    1 059 kr

    Beställningsvara. Skickas inom 3-6 vardagar. Fri frakt över 249 kr.

    Beskrivning

    A complete clinically focused guide to managing the full spectrum of kidney diseases and hypertensionFor more than 70 years, professors, students, and clinicians have trusted LANGE for high-quality, current, concise medical information in a convenient, affordable, portable format. Whether for coursework, clerkships, USMLE prep, specialty board review, or patient care, there's a LANGE book that guarantees success.A Doody's Core Title!"an up-to-date, accessible guide that covers all major clinical aspects of the adult patient with diseases involving the kidneys and hypertension. Numerous figures and tables are well integrated into structured chapters creating an easy flow of information that helps readers capture key points....In contrast to many other books in this area, this one provides a concise yet comprehensive review of each topic without getting lost in too much detail that interested readers can find in other places. It is a clinically useful tool for anybody interested in the field....Given its concise but comprehensive structure, this book is a great resource for students and residents who want to review basic physiology and pathophysiology but also get up-to-date information on diagnosis and therapy. The wide range of topics also makes it a useful tool for any clinicians at a more senior level who want to quickly review a particular subject. Lastly, due to its easily accessible structure, patients and families seeking medical information also might find it useful. 3 Stars."--Doody's Review ServicePresented in the consistent, easy-to-follow CURRENT style, CURRENT Diagnosis & Treatment Nephrology & Hypertension offers incisive, ready-to-use management protocols and valuable therapeutic guidelines -- from authors who are recognized as the field's foremost authorities.Accessible, concise, and up-to-date, CURRENT Diagnosis & Treatment Nephrology & Hypertension features:One-of-a-kind clinical overview of all major diseases and disorders, from end-stage renal disease to primary and secondary hypertensionA practical, learn-as-you-go approach to diagnosing and treating renal disorders and hypertension that combines disease management techniques with the latest clinically proven therapies Up-to-date coverage of transplantation medicine and need-to-know interventional procedures An important review of subspecialty considerations: renal disease in the elderly, diabetic nephropathy, critical care nephrology, and dialysisExpert authorship from prominent clinicians in the areas of kidney disease, dialysis, and hypertension

    Drs. Nissenson and Fine are known internationally for their work in dialysis and have pioneered a number of technical and clinical advances. Dr. Fine invented the first machine capable of providing hemodialysis to children.
